Output ddaa5dc00b3131656b44dd4e975fd61d6609b0a6dbf83f2d3b58dc25e28d0256:8

value
258089
script pubkey
OP_0 OP_PUSHBYTES_20 95a2ddfe0f26d404c14d08df060f5a9aad8b0855
address
bc1qjk3dmls0ym2qfs2dpr0svr66n2kckzz4htshse
transaction
ddaa5dc00b3131656b44dd4e975fd61d6609b0a6dbf83f2d3b58dc25e28d0256
spent
true